Q: How do you remove the front and rear bumper covers on Saturn Vue?
A: To remove the front bumper cover for 2005 and earlier models, first apply the parking brake, raise the vehicle, and support it securely on jackstands. Remove the headlights and parking lights, then take out the screws and pushpins from the front air dam and lift it off. Use a small screwdriver to pop the center button up on the plastic fasteners without removing the center buttons. Unclip the front inner fender splash shields from the bumper cover and pull the liners to the rear or remove them completely. Disconnect the fog lights if equipped, then unbolt the bumper cover from the lower front part of each fender, accessible after removing the inner fender splash shields. Remove the retainers from the top and bottom of the bumper cover, pull it forward to release the lock tabs from the fenders, and lift off the cover. Installation is the reverse of removal, ensuring the tabs on the back of the bumper cover fit into the corresponding clips on the body before installing the fasteners, with an assistant being helpful. For 2006 and later models, begin by removing the headlights, then for standard models, take off the upper grille, hood stop bumpers, and upper bumper support. For all models, remove the fasteners from the lower air dam and lift it off, then remove the two pushpins from the front of each wheel well liner, and pull the bumper cover forward to release it as you lift it off, with installation being the reverse of removal. To remove the rear bumper cover for 2005 and earlier models, take out the inner fender splash shields attached with plastic pushpins, open the liftgate, and remove the pushpin fasteners from the top of the bumper cover. Detach the fasteners securing the bottom of the bumper cover, unclip each end from the body by working through the wheel wells to reach the tabs, and pull the bumper cover out and away from the vehicle, with installation being the reverse of removal. For 2006 and later models, open the liftgate and remove the six pushpin fasteners from the top of the bumper cover, then remove the four fasteners from the bottom and the two fasteners at each end inside the wheel wells before pulling the bumper cover out and away from the vehicle, with installation being the reverse of removal.
